USB Charger was recalled on 17 August 2012 under EU Safety Gate alert A12/1217/12. Electric shock, Fire risk reported by France. The product poses a risk of electric shock and fire because there is no additional fastening of the various soldered connections of the primary circuit: if a wire disconnects, the creepage distances and the clearances can be reduced.

Risk Description

The product poses a risk of electric shock and fire because there is no additional fastening of the various soldered connections of the primary circuit: if a wire disconnects, the creepage distances and the clearances can be reduced. The product does not comply with the Low Voltage Directive and the relevant European standard EN 60950.

Measures Taken

Type of economic operator taking notified measure(s): OtherCategory of measure(s): Withdrawal of the product from the marketDate of entry into force: Unknown

Product Description

Mains charger for USB-powered devices in clear blister packaging
